The "L02b-16-new Update Download" primarily refers to specialized firmware used for unlocking and modifying MiFi devices, specifically those with board versions related to the L02 series (such as L02B or L02C). These updates are often sought by users looking to "open-line" their mobile hotspots, allowing them to use SIM cards from different network providers. What is the L02b-16-new Update?
The L02b-16-new update is a specific firmware iteration designed for 4G LTE MiFi devices like the M028T or M023T. It is frequently associated with "Openline Modified Firmware" that has been tweaked to:
Enable LCD Displays: Restore or enhance screen functionality on devices where it might have been disabled.
MEP Settings Access: Provide access to the MEP (Mobile Equipment Personalization) settings required for entering unlock codes.
Carrier Freedom: Allow the use of non-default SIM cards, such as shifting a locked Airtel device to other 3G/4G networks. Key Features of the Update
Enhanced Compatibility: Newer firmware versions like the "16-new" series often aim to improve 4G signal stability, though some early versions may still face connectivity hurdles that require manual configuration.
Modified Bootloaders: The update includes critical bootloader files (fbf) like NTIM and OBMI that must match the device's board date to initialize correctly. L02b-16-new Update Download
Bug Fixes: Often addresses issues where the device might get stuck during the flashing process or fail to recognize certain network bands. How to Perform the Update and Download
Updating these devices typically requires a desktop tool like SWDownloader and specific drivers for WTPTP or LTE generic devices.
Prepare the Environment: Ensure you have installed the necessary USB drivers on your PC.
Load the Files: Open your downloading tool (e.g., SWDownloader) and load the L02b-16-new firmware files. Ensure all necessary checkboxes, like RBL1 and RBLR, are ticked.
Wipe the Flash: Some advanced procedures involve disconnecting the device during the "erasing flash" stage (around 3-6%) to force a downgrade that permits custom firmware.
Flash the Firmware: Connect the MiFi (often without the battery) to start the burning process.
Unlock: Once flashed, you may need to login to the device's IP (usually via a browser with "admin" credentials) and enter a universal unlock code like 123456 in the MEP settings. Critical Considerations
Version Matching: A common error occurs if your device has a newer board date (e.g., version 17XXXXX) than the firmware you are trying to flash (version 16XXXXX). In such cases, the system may block the update to prevent bricking.
Manual Configuration: After updating, users often need to manually configure wireless and APN settings to ensure the internet functions correctly with new carriers. UNLOCK M028T/M023T [L02C]-BOARD VERSION-16XXXXX

Before initiating the download of L02b-16-new, the prudent engineer must first conduct a thorough audit of the existing environment. This pre-installation phase is not merely administrative but diagnostic. The update’s designation—L02b-16-new—implies a lineage; it likely supersedes previous iterations (e.g., L02b-15) or addresses a specific hardware revision (Rev 02b). Therefore, the primary step is confirming that the target device’s current firmware version, hardware compatibility list, and available storage space align with the update’s manifest. Many deployment failures stem not from corrupted code, but from a mismatch between expectation and reality. For instance, attempting to install L02b-16-new on a device with insufficient volatile memory could trigger a boot loop. Thus, reading the accompanying release notes—specifically the “dependencies” and “breaking changes” sections—is as crucial as the download itself.
The acquisition of the L02b-16-new binary file is the next critical juncture, and it is here that security hygiene proves paramount. In an era of supply chain attacks and spoofed update servers, the source of the download dictates the integrity of the entire operation. The update must be retrieved exclusively from the original equipment manufacturer’s (OEM) authenticated portal or a verified repository with cryptographic signatures. A common yet dangerous practice is sourcing the update from third-party forums or peer-to-peer networks under the guise of convenience. While the filename “L02b-16-new” may appear identical, an unofficial copy could contain injected malware, stripped error handling, or even a deliberate bricking routine. To mitigate this, users should always verify the SHA-256 checksum of the downloaded file against the hash provided on the official changelog. Without this checksum verification, the update remains an unverified foreign agent entering a trusted system.
Finally, the execution of the L02b-16-new update demands a controlled, non-destructive environment. This means disconnecting non-essential peripherals, ensuring an uninterruptible power supply (or a battery level above 80%), and backing up the current working configuration. The update process itself—whether via USB bootloader, over-the-air push, or JTAG interface—should be monitored in real-time. It is during this write phase that the system is most vulnerable; an interruption of even 200 milliseconds can corrupt the boot sector. After the mandatory reboot cycle, the post-validation phase begins. Here, the engineer must not assume success based solely on a “Update Complete” dialog. Instead, they should query the system’s new version string, run a diagnostic self-test, and verify that previously logged issues (e.g., the “stuttering ADC read” or “spurious UART interrupt” that L02b-16-new purports to fix) are indeed resolved. Only upon passing these functional tests can the deployment be considered a success.
